(senza oggetto)

ale torero piccolograndeprincipe@hotmail.com
Gio 26 Maggio 2005 16:24:45 CEST


Stiamo scrivendo uno script di bash che si collega via telnet su una serie 
di ip, esegue un login
automatico e lancia alcuni comandi. Reindirizziamo poi l'output di ogni 
telnet su un file di log
nominato con l'indirizzo ip. Il problema è che vorremmo (ri)nominare ogni 
file di log generato
con il nome del nodo corrispondente presente su un altro file, ma non 
riusciamo ad incrementare
due variabili contemporaneamente. Se cortesemente hai una soluzione ti 
saremmo molto grati.
Di seguito lo script:

#!/bin/bash

. ip   # file contenente gli ip su cui collegarsi

for ip in $IP
do
(
          sleep 2
          echo "username"
          sleep 2
          echo "password"
          sleep 2
          echo "comano"
          sleep 2

) | telnet $ip > $ip

done
exit 0

_________________________________________________________________
Comunica in tempo reale http://messenger.msn.com/beta



Maggiori informazioni sulla lista palermo